Esempio n. 1
0
        static void Main(string [] args)
        {
            Calculo infoPlayer = new Calculo();

            System.Console.WriteLine(infoPlayer.Calcular());

            System.Console.WriteLine(infoPlayer.Calcular(120));

            System.Console.WriteLine(infoPlayer.Calcular(120, 200));

            System.Console.WriteLine(infoPlayer.Calcular("Excalibur", "Lendária"));
        }
Esempio n. 2
0
        static void Main(string[] args)
        {
            Calculo infoPlayer = new Calculo();

            // Sem argumentos
            System.Console.WriteLine(infoPlayer.Calcular());

            // Com 1 argumento int
            System.Console.WriteLine(infoPlayer.Calcular(100));

            // Com 2 argumentos int
            System.Console.WriteLine(infoPlayer.Calcular(100, 40));

            // Com 2 argumentos string
            System.Console.WriteLine(infoPlayer.Calcular("John", "Wick"));
        }
Esempio n. 3
0
        public async Task <Calculo> CriarCalculo(Calculo calculo)
        {
            if (calculo.Tipo_Calculo == "") // Validação (Condição) antes de salvar no bacno;
            {
                throw new ArgumentException("Qual o tipo do calculo? se Simples digite S, se composto digite C.");
            }
            calculo.Calcular();

            return(await calculoRepository.CriarCalculo(calculo)); // Salvar no banco;
        }
Esempio n. 4
0
        static void Main(string[] args)
        {
            Calculo infoPlayer = new Calculo();

            //primeira opçao sem argumento
            System.Console.WriteLine(infoPlayer.Calcular());

            //segunda opcao
            System.Console.WriteLine(infoPlayer.Calcular(100));

            //terceira opçao

            System.Console.WriteLine(infoPlayer.Calcular(100, 1000));

            //quarta opçao

            System.Console.WriteLine(infoPlayer.Calcular("Tony", "Stark"));

            System.Console.WriteLine(infoPlayer.Calcular("Homem de ferro"));
        }